Funchal

Funchal is the capital city of the autonomous region of Madeira on the island of Madeira. The city is located to the south between the cities of Santa Cruz and Camara de Lobos. It is actually named for the fennel plant which grows liberally on the island. The city was most significant as a shipping center between the 15th and 17th centuries. Today it has a population of over 100,000 people and is, arguably, one of the most picturesque cities in Portugal. It's appeal as a tourist destination has made it the leading Portuguese port for cruise line dockings.

Antwerp

Antwerp is a very popular tourist destination in Belgium. It's a lovely city in the region of Flanders and its people are known for their friendly, open and welcoming personalities. It's a very relaxed and low stress city, making it an excellent place to spend a few days in the midst of a hectic trip. The city itself is known to have a very high standard of living and a great quality of life. Antwerp is also an economic center in Belgium, because of its importance in the diamond trade. It is known as the "world's leading diamond city" with about seventy percent of all diamonds traded through Antwerp.

Which place is cheaper, Antwerp or Funchal?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Funchal is €93, while the average daily cost in Antwerp is €123.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Funchal and Antwerp in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Funchal or Antwerp?

Both places have a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. As both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Funchal or Antwerp in the Summer?

The summer brings many poeple to Funchal as well as Antwerp. Additionally, many travelers come to Antwerp for the city activities and the family-friendly experiences.

Funchal is a little warmer than Antwerp in the summer. The daily temperature in Funchal averages around 22°C (72°F) in July, and Antwerp fluctuates around 17°C (63°F).

The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Antwerp. People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Funchal this time of the year. In the summer, Funchal often gets more sunshine than Antwerp. Funchal gets 227 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Antwerp receives 202 hours of full sun.

Funchal usually gets less rain in July than Antwerp. Funchal gets 10 mm (0.4 in) of rain, while Antwerp receives 66 mm (2.6 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Funchal or Antwerp in the Autumn?

Both Antwerp and Funchal are popular destinations to visit in the autumn with plenty of activities. Also, many visitors come to Antwerp in the autumn for the city's sights and attractions and the shopping scene.

In the autumn, Funchal is much warmer than Antwerp. Typically, the autumn temperatures in Funchal in October average around 21°C (70°F), and Antwerp averages at about 12°C (54°F).

Funchal usually receives more sunshine than Antwerp during autumn. Funchal gets 183 hours of sunny skies, while Antwerp receives 105 hours of full sun in the autumn.

It's quite rainy in Funchal. In October, Funchal usually receives more rain than Antwerp. Funchal gets 100 mm (3.9 in) of rain, while Antwerp receives 78 mm (3.1 in) of rain each month for the autumn.

Should I visit Funchal or Antwerp in the Winter?

Both Antwerp and Funchal during the winter are popular places to visit. Also, most visitors come to Antwerp for the museums, the shopping scene, and the cuisine during these months.

Antwerp can be very cold during winter. In January, Funchal is generally much warmer than Antwerp. Daily temperatures in Funchal average around 16°C (61°F), and Antwerp fluctuates around 3°C (38°F).

In the winter, Funchal often gets more sunshine than Antwerp. Funchal gets 141 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Antwerp receives 47 hours of full sun.

It rains a lot this time of the year in Funchal. Funchal usually gets more rain in January than Antwerp. Funchal gets 110 mm (4.3 in) of rain, while Antwerp receives 59 mm (2.3 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Funchal or Antwerp in the Spring?

The spring attracts plenty of travelers to both Funchal and Antwerp. Also, the spring months attract visitors to Antwerp because of the activities around the city.

Funchal is much warmer than Antwerp in the spring. The daily temperature in Funchal averages around 17°C (63°F) in April, and Antwerp fluctuates around 8°C (47°F).

Funchal usually receives more sunshine than Antwerp during spring. Funchal gets 182 hours of sunny skies, while Antwerp receives 158 hours of full sun in the spring.

In April, Funchal usually receives more rain than Antwerp. Funchal gets 70 mm (2.8 in) of rain, while Antwerp receives 45 mm (1.8 in) of rain each month for the spring.

Typical Weather for Antwerp and Funchal

Funchal Antwerp
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 16°C (61°F) 110 mm (4.3 in) 3°C (38°F) 59 mm (2.3 in)
Feb 16°C (61°F) 80 mm (3.1 in) 3°C (38°F) 44 mm (1.7 in)
Mar 16°C (61°F) 60 mm (2.4 in) 6°C (42°F) 55 mm (2.2 in)
Apr 17°C (63°F) 70 mm (2.8 in) 8°C (47°F) 45 mm (1.8 in)
May 19°C (66°F) 20 mm (0.8 in) 12°C (54°F) 49 mm (1.9 in)
Jun 21°C (70°F) 10 mm (0.4 in) 15°C (59°F) 62 mm (2.4 in)
Jul 22°C (72°F) 10 mm (0.4 in) 17°C (63°F) 66 mm (2.6 in)
Aug 23°C (73°F) 10 mm (0.4 in) 18°C (64°F) 67 mm (2.6 in)
Sep 23°C (73°F) 40 mm (1.6 in) 16°C (60°F) 62 mm (2.4 in)
Oct 21°C (70°F) 100 mm (3.9 in) 12°C (54°F) 78 mm (3.1 in)
Nov 19°C (66°F) 100 mm (3.9 in) 7°C (45°F) 75 mm (2.9 in)
Dec 18°C (64°F) 90 mm (3.5 in) 5°C (40°F) 71 mm (2.8 in)
